Albert Janes and Sons

From Graces Guide

Furniture maker, of High Wycombe

1869 Mr Janes started business.

Second to Hutchinsons in getting away from ordinary cane and Windsor chairs.

Cited by Charles Skull as one of the first few firms to raise the standard of workmanship.

1928 Janes and Son and Smith in Hamilton Road

1951 Mr R A Janes in charge
